Quarterly Planning Note — Divestiture of the Coastal Tooling Unit

For the finance team: the sale of the Coastal Tooling unit to Pellmark Industries remains on track for close in Q3. Please finalize the carve-out balance sheet, reconcile intercompany positions, and prepare the working-capital adjustment schedule by month-end. Audit support requests should be prioritized. For planning purposes, note the following sensitive item:

internal memo for hawef-kahif: The finance team signed off on a budget of $25.9 million for Project Sorox. The renewal with Pelokek Logistics closes at $51.7 million a year, 52 percent below the last contract.

## Account Recovery — Trailnote Offline Mode

When a surveyor's Trailnote app has been offline for 30+ days, their local credentials expire and sync refuses to resume. Don't make them wipe the device — all their unsynced field data lives there! Instead, open the support console, pick "Offline Reinstate," and enter their handle. The console will ask for the support team's shared recovery passphrase before issuing a reinstatement token. Use the one below.

unlock words, bagaf-fajeg: zorael-kelax-fraath-quenix-eliok-sileth-aldmir-wenir-druiel

### Changed defaults — Pairstone Matching Service 7.1

Garbage-collection pauses were causing match timeouts under peak load, so we switched the default collector to the low-pause variant and reduced heap headroom accordingly. Throughput drops about three percent, but p99 pause time falls from 900ms to under 40ms. No security-relevant surfaces changed; memory limits are still enforced per tenant. For review purposes, the updated default configuration now reads as follows.

service settings:
novath:
  pin: 1396
  tenant: pelys
  seal: seal_ccc035e1
  metrics_host: metrics.novath.qorvelworks.test
  standby_team: fraeth
  escalation: drueth-zorok
  nonce: 61d508

## Build Provenance — Nightglean Scheduler

Welcome aboard. Nightglean, our scheduler for nightly data backfills, is built exclusively on the Corvel pipeline; artifacts built anywhere else must not be deployed. Each build embeds its source revision, builder identity, and a signed manifest. Before promoting a release to the Dunmore environment, verify the manifest signature and cross-check the revision against the changelog. The provenance token for the current approved build appears below.

session token of tajog-fahaf = htk21_4ae55819f45410afcb307